Storage unit payments are typically billed monthly, with charges due at the beginning of each billing cycle.Most facilities require payment in advance, not after you use the unit.
When you rent a storage unit, you are placed on a monthly billing cycle.This means:• You are charged once per month• Payments renew automatically• Your due date stays the same each cycleThis is standard across most facilities.
Unlike some services, storage is paid in advance.You pay for the upcoming month, not the previous one.This is important when planning move-in and move-out timing.
Your due date is the day your payment is required each month.If payment is not made on time:• Late fees may be added• Access to your unit may be restricted• Additional penalties can apply over timeStaying on schedule avoids unnecessary issues.
Most storage facilities accept multiple payment options.These often include:• Credit or debit card
• Online payments
• Automatic billing
• In-person paymentsAuto-pay is commonly used to avoid missed payments.
Yes, in many cases storage rates can change.This is typically outlined in your rental agreement.Because billing is month-to-month, adjustments can happen over time.
Most storage facilities do not prorate unused days.This means:• You may not receive a refund• Timing your move-out matters• Ending before the next billing cycle is importantPlanning ahead can prevent paying for extra time.
In addition to the base monthly rate, some facilities may include:• Late fees
• Administrative fees
• Optional add-onsThese vary depending on the facility.
Storage billing seems simple, but small details can create confusion.Common misunderstandings include:• Thinking payment is after use• Expecting partial refunds• Not tracking billing dates• Overlooking automatic renewalsUnderstanding the system avoids surprises.
Many renters run into issues because they do not fully understand billing.Common mistakes include:• Missing due dates• Not setting up auto-pay• Moving out after the billing date• Ignoring payment notificationsThese mistakes can lead to extra costs.
